Rethinking Aging – A Conversation with Larry Bonistalli from Stanford Longevity Initiative I recently had the opportunity to speak with Larry from the Stanford Longevity Initiative about a topic that is becoming increasingly important: aging. Larry and his team have developed an innovative vision, showing how a long life can be embraced as an opportunity through a holistic approach that combines education, health, social integration, and lifelong learning. The "New Map of Life"—a groundbreaking life plan with 10 guiding principles—promotes healthy life phases, investment in education and technology, community-building, and flexible work models. I was especially inspired by the focus on lifelong learning and the potential it creates for older generations within companies. Aging is not a disadvantage but a resource and a phase of growth. The Stanford Center shows us that with targeted investments in education and health, and by creating work models that are flexible and inclusive, people of all ages can make valuable contributions.
